Extend Due Date of submitting Income Tax Return & TAR for F.Y 2020-21 till 31st Mar 2022

(i) There has been a sudden spurt of the Omicron / Covid virus and due to the geometrical rise in the number of Covid cases, various Govts. have already put severe restrictions & curbs on the movement of people, resulting in a state of curfew and partial lockdown. It has become extremely difficult and close to impossible for the taxpayers to collect & collate the data and information required to file the income tax returns and also pass the same to their respective professionals for uploading it on the portal. The restrictions imposed by the Govt. have left, both the taxpayers as well as the professionals virtually stranded / handicapped to go ahead and file the Tax Audit Reports and the income tax returns.
(ii) The new Income Tax portal had actually become functional only during the end of September, 2021 and the same, though functional, is still continuing, albeit a lot of glitches and difficulties. The taxpayers as well as the professionals are still facing many a problem in uploading the information required for Tax Audit Reports and filling up the relevant Income Tax Forms on the portal.
(iii) The Department has also been updating and upgrading the various Utilities and General Instructions on the portal, from time to time. For instance, the Utility for ITR -5 was updated only on 9th December, 2021 and for ITR -6 on 3rd December, 2021. Similarly, for Forms 3CA / CB-3CD, the latest version was released only on 9th December, 2021. The taxpayers, professionals are taking time to understand and then upload the information required to fill these Forms. At the same time, even the software companies have taken quite a lot of time to modify and amend their respective software and this is resulting in consequential delays for the taxpayers to file the Tax Audit Reports and the income tax returns.
(iv) The recently introduced systems of AIS (Annual Information System) and TIS (Tax Information Summary) on the Income Tax portal is a very new thing for the taxpayers and is resulting in lots of difficulties and anomalies for them to reconcile the information & details. This reconciliation of information is taking a very long time and it may not be possible to submit the income tax returns by the aforesaid due dates.
It is due to the aforesaid reasons and many other related reasons that it may not be practically possible for a large number of assessees / professionals to collect information and details necessary / required for filing of the Tax Audit Reports & the Income Tax returns by the prescribed due dates. We therefore, sincerely pray that due dates for uploading the information and filing the Tax Audit Reports be extended upto 31st March, 2022, so that professionals are not put to undue stress for timely compliances and consequential interest & penalties etc. This act of extension of the due dates, by passing suitable Orders and issuing Notifications would be very useful for the taxpayers and a great relief for the taxation fraternity.
